Man Utd Transfer Update: Red Devils Concerned About Bruno Fernandes Leaving as Florian Wirtz Joining Liverpool Sparks Major Chain Reaction

Manchester United are set to be caught in the crossfire of Florian Wirtz’s transfer to Liverpool.

A deal to take the Germany international to Anfield from Bayer Leverkusen has accelerated dramatically in recent hours, such that an official announcement for the move could come within the next few days.

This is because Bayern Munich are shifting their focus onto other targets after missing out on their dream signing, with TEAMtalk now claiming that none other than Bruno Fernandes has appeared on their radar.

The Man Utd captain is enjoying one of the best personal seasons of his career, which stands in stark contrast to the misery he has experienced at club level. Languishing 16th in the table and having lost the Europa League final, Man Utd are at the lowest point in their modern-day history.

Bayern want Fernandes

Fernandes has already announced that he is not actively looking to leave Man Utd, but that he may have no choice if he feels the club can’t match his ambitions.

The Portugal international has a lucrative Saudi offer on the table, but he has been told that he needs to make a decision before the week is out. With Fernandes yet to respond, it seems unlikely that he will head to the Middle East this summer.

However, Bayern could now offer him the chance to remain in Europe and compete at the highest level. According to the above-mentioned report, the Bundesliga champions have requested a meeting with Fernandes’ camp to discuss a potential move.

There were already rumours of purported interest in Fernandes last summer, but precious little ultimately came of it. Bayern are keen to make their team younger and, according to German media, are focusing more on wide players now, so this new speculation will likely remain just that.
